Walt’s Apartment Gets Seasonal Decor Despite Disneyland’s Closure
We’ve got a story for your Saturday evening that really warms our holiday hearts. Despite being closed for 10 months in 2020, Disneyland isn’t forgetting to pay tribute to Walt Disney this holiday season.
Josh D’Amaro took to Instagram to share an image of Walt’s apartment on Main Street USA in Disneyland theme park where you’ll find a very special seasonal surprise!

D’Amaro Says of visit, “Stopped into the Disneyland Resort this week and was delighted to see the Resort Enhancement team had installed the tree in Walt’s Apartment — we always leave a light on for him. I had to share since I know you won’t be able to see it this year. Be safe everyone. Happy Holidays!”
Disneyland theme park was forced to close in February of 2020 at the start of the COVID-19 pandemic and with stringent requirements in the State of California to combat the spread of COVID-19 has remained closed ever since.
As of going to print, the only areas of Disneyland Resort to be open to the public are Downtown Disney as well as a section of Buena Vista Street. Both areas are open for shopping and takeaway dining options.
Because of the continued spread of COVID-19 in the state of California there hasn’t been any indication of when Disneyland Resort may reopen. However, its nice to know that Walt’s legacy lives on even without the crowds.
Since Disneyland is the park that Walt built, he famously had his own personal apartment located above the Fire Station in Disneyland theme park right on Main Street. Over the years, a lone candle has graced the window of Walt’s apparent to honor his legacy. Be sure to look out for it during your next Disney visit.
